Gabrielle advises debtors, creditors, creditors’ committees, and trustees in Chapter 7, Subchapter V, and Chapter 11 bankruptcy cases. She also represents clients in complex commercial litigation, out-of-court workouts, collection matters, and other business and insolvency-related disputes in state and federal courts.
